हाकारा । hākārā : a bi-lingual journal of creative expression[edit]


हाकारा । hākārā (नाम/noun) //: (m) हाक, बोलावणे; a call, a general or a great and continued calling

हाकारा । hākārā, is an online bilingual journal of creative expression published online. With a thematic focus for each issue, the journal is published in English and Marathi while exploring a wide range of forms including critical writings, art works, fiction and videos.

Published once in three months, हाकारा । hākārā has been initiated by writer and scholar, Ashutosh Potdar. He co-edits हाकारा । hākārā with Noopur Desai, art-writer and researchers.
